Essendon Bombers vs Fremantle Dockers Prediction - Round 10 2026
15/05/2026|Josh Jenkins|AFL Tips & PredictionsRound 10 of the AFL season sees the second-last placed Essendon Bombers host the ladder leading Fremantle Dockers at the MCG.
Looking to equal the longest winning streak in club history; in-form Fremantle Club run the risk of complacency as they visit the basket-case Dons.
The Dockers secured their eighth consecutive victory by overturning a 19-point final-quarter deficit to defeat Hawthorn 88-73 at Optus Stadium last week.
Elsewhere, Essendon dropped to 1-8 in 2026 through a 103-89 result against GWS at ENGIE Stadium after failing to capitalise on a 26-point third-quarter lead.
The loss maintained a counterintuitive run of form for the Bombers, who are 1-3 with an average losing margin of 28.7 points when playing interstate this season, compared to 0-5 while losing on average by 49.8 points in Melbourne.
Fremantle won last season’s fixture against Essendon 104-63 at Optus Stadium; we’d expect a similar result in this one - but the Home of Football is a magical place and anything can happen in a game of footy.

Essendon Bombers vs Fremantle Dockers Match Predictions and Betting Tips
Head-to-Head Prediction
Essendon restored some faith in their ability to compete after pushing GWS in western Sydney last week.
The game style still irks us, but competitiveness matters and if that’s how they feel they can compete, so be it. But it won’t be winning games that matter against the best!
For the Dockers, they sprung to life when it mattered and claimed victory over the Hawks; a win which likely means plenty when we discuss positions in the finals.
This is one they need to turn up for, handle, and win.
There’s no issue about being up and down at this point in the season. Josh Treacy seems due a big bag of goals, too.
Head-to-head prediction: Fremantle Dockers by 27 points.
First Goal Scorer Prediction
First goal is a toss-up between Jye Amiss and Josh Treacy who have kicked over 40 goals combined this season.
These two talls are the tip of the spear for a dominant Fremantle outfit and should relish the delivery coming their way against a Bombers defense that has struggled to stem the flow of goals.
We are going with Jye Amiss in this one, but it could just as easily be Treacy given his current form.
Betting tip: Jye Amiss.
Most Disposals Prediction
Archie Roberts is currently averaging the second most disposals in the league from Half Back as the struggling Bombers shift the ball out of their defensive end.
He has notched up 42 disposals three times this season and is likely to be putting in another big shift as Freo keep the contest in Essendon's half.
Expect him to be the primary outlet for the Dons all afternoon.
Betting tip: Archie Roberts.
